Crisafulli Case History - Submersible Hydraulic Pumps Used In Exxon's Valdez Oil Spill Cleanup

During early June, 1989, Northwest EnviroField Services (West Pac Environmental) traveled to Valdez, Alaska in response to a request for introduction from the Exxon Corporation, Houston, Texas. During this visit it was observed that although the removal and cleanup of crude oil from Prince William Sound was the focal point of all intellect, an unforeseen or pending issue of considerable magnitude was starting to surface. This issue regarded the removal of the recovered crude oil from the various types of barges on lease to Exxon. With daily rental rates ranging from $3,000 to $7,000 it was noted during several discussions with barge personnel that the off-loading of the recovered oil was of little concern, for the longer the sour crude remained aboard, the greater financial dividends to be made. Following the June visit to Valdez several contracts were awarded to Northwest Environmental Field Services (West Pac Environmental) with the most challenging requiring the off-loading of the Exxon leased barges. In many of the cargo holds the crude oil, with its heavy paraffins and high sulfur content had emulsified with its associated sea water and was so heavy and viscous that a demonstration proved that it could not be poured out of a 55 gallon drum! In addition, the gluey mousse was riddled with seaweed, kelp, rocks, and other debris. Northwest EnviroField Services (West Pac Environmental) successfully off-loaded in excess of 10,000,000 gallons of this Valdez crude utilizing their expertise, centralized heat and the reliable power of their CRISAFULLI submersible pumps. The CRISAFULLI pump was outfitted with a masticator blade which literally chewed up most of the debris it encountered. The CRISAFULLI pumps were run 24 hours daily and in an environment that would destroy almost anything with moving parts. In late December of 1989 and early January 1990, the Exxon Corporation decided to off-load their two remaining barges of Valdez crude in Texas City, Texas. As a gesture of goodwill toward the local contractors, Northwest EnviroField Services (West Pac Environmental) was retained for their expertise and project control but the critical off-loading responsibilities were given to a local contractor. This contractor boasted that he manufactured the most reputable pumps in the world.  As a matter of fact, this manufacturer detailed how their pumps could pump ice cold molasses that was near rock hard for distances in excess of 1,000 feet!  At the conclusion of this statement, I looked at my fellow associate, Mr. Larson, and we both uncontrollably smiled. Prior to off-loading activities, a large crane was used to place the hydraulic power pack for the new pumping system aboard the barge of Valdez mousse. Within 48 hours the pumping contractor admitted defeat and quickly disappeared from the job site. Once again Northwest EnviroField Services utilized the services of their CRISAFULLI arsenal and, as expected, the integrity and performance of the CRISAFULLI pump was outstanding.
